What are Quick Skin Wheel Covers?

Quick skin wheel covers, also known as snap-on wheel covers or hubcaps, are designed for easy installation and removal. Unlike traditional wheel covers that might require tools or specific techniques, these simply snap onto your existing wheels, providing a protective layer and a stylish makeover in minutes. They are an excellent choice for those seeking a temporary fix, seasonal change, or a budget-friendly way to enhance their vehicle's aesthetic appeal.

Choosing the Right Quick Skin Wheel Covers

Selecting the perfect quick skin wheel covers involves considering several key factors:

1. Wheel Size and Type:

Accurate measurements are crucial. Before purchasing, carefully measure your wheel diameter (usually indicated as 15", 16", 17", etc.) and ensure the covers are compatible with your vehicle's wheel type (steel or alloy). Incorrect sizing will lead to a poor fit and potentially damage your wheels.

2. Material and Durability:

Quick skin wheel covers are typically made from plastic, ABS plastic, or sometimes a blend of materials. ABS plastic is generally preferred for its durability and resistance to impact and fading. Consider the climate in your area; some materials might fare better in extreme temperatures than others.

3. Style and Design:

From sporty to classic, the variety in design is vast. Choose a style that complements your vehicle's overall look and your personal preference. Consider the color, finish (glossy, matte, etc.), and any decorative elements.

4. Price and Value:

While affordability is a significant advantage of quick skin wheel covers, avoid extremely cheap options, as these often lack durability and may not provide a secure fit. Look for a balance between price and quality.

Easy Installation: A Step-by-Step Guide

Most quick skin wheel covers are incredibly easy to install. The process typically involves:

  1. Cleaning your wheels: Remove any dirt, grime, or debris from your wheels for optimal adhesion.
  2. Aligning the cover: Carefully position the wheel cover over your existing wheel, ensuring it's centered.
  3. Snapping it into place: Press firmly and evenly around the circumference until you hear the cover securely snap into place. Some covers may have clips or locking mechanisms.

Note: Always refer to the manufacturer's instructions for specific installation guidelines.

Maintenance and Care Tips

To prolong the lifespan of your quick skin wheel covers, follow these simple maintenance tips:

  • Regular Cleaning: Wash your wheel covers regularly with soap and water to remove dirt and road grime.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
  • Careful Handling: Avoid hitting curbs or potholes that could damage the covers.
  • Seasonal Storage: If you're switching out your covers seasonally, store them in a clean, dry place to prevent damage.
